The Divine Geometry of Dom Luigi Guido Grandi
In the twilight of the Baroque era, a period defined by dramatic movement and profound spiritual intensity, there emerged a figure who sought to find the fingerprints of the Creator within the precise language of mathematics. Dom Luigi Guido Grandi (1671–1742) was far more than a mere scholar; he was a Benedictine monk whose life served as a bridge between the contemplative silence of the monastery and the burgeoning analytical rigor of the Enlightenment. Born in Italy, Grandi’s existence was shaped by the sacred atmosphere of San Luigi dei Francesi in Rome, where the intersection of Catholic theology and classical learning provided the fertile soil for his intellectual blossoming.
To understand Grandi is to understand a mind that viewed geometry not as an abstract set of rules, but as a window into the divine order. His early education instilled in him a reverence for the structural beauty of the universe, leading him to pursue mathematical truths as a form of worship. Influenced by the revolutionary spirit of Galileo Galilei, Grandi navigated the delicate tension between established religious dogma and the emerging scientific discoveries that were reshaping the European consciousness. He did not see science and faith as opposing forces, but rather as two different lenses through which one might perceive the same eternal truth.
Mathematical Elegance and the Rose Curve
The legacy of Grandi is etched into the very fabric of mathematical history through his breathtaking contributions to geometry and calculus. Perhaps his most visually captivating achievement is the formulation of what is now known as the Rose Curve. This geometric marvel, characterized by its delicate, petal-like symmetry radiating from a central point, serves as a perfect metaphor for his life's work—a marriage of mathematical precision and organic beauty. When one observes the rhythmic expansion of these curves, one sees the same elegance that Grandi sought to find in the heavens.
